What advice do you have for expats having a baby in Los Alcazares?
We asked expat moms who gave birth in Los Alcazares about their experiences and advice they have for other moms to be. They said...
"It is important to do some research on the healthcare system in the area you are living in as you may need to consider your birth plan in advance. Make sure you speak to your expat health insurance provider to make sure that your cover is adequate for potential maternity costs. Make sure to research the local doctor, hospital and any specialised maternity services that may be available to you. Lastly, establish a good network of expat mums so that you can share your experiences and receive advice," remarked another expat who made the move to Los Alcazares, Spain.
